Legislature
- EnglishThe Chamber of Senators will be composed of forty-five titular [members] at minimum, and of thirty substitutes, elected directly by the People in one sole national circumscription. The law may increase the quantity of Senators, accordingly to the increment of the electors.
The natural Paraguayan nationality and to be already thirty-five years old are required to be elected Senator[,] titular or substitute. (Art. 223) - SpanishLa Cámara de Senadores se compondrá de cuarenta y cinco miembros titulares como mínimo, y de treinta suplentes, elegidos directamente por el pueblo en una sola circunscripción nacional.
La ley podrá acrecentar la cantidad de senadores, conforme con el aumento de los electores.
Para ser electo senador titular o suplente se requieren la nacionalidad paraguaya natural y haber cumplido treinta y cinco años. (Art. 223)

Legislature
- EnglishThe Senate is composed of elected members, one for each province and one for the National District, who shall exercise their role for four years. (Art. 78)
- SpanishEl Senado se compone de miembros elegidos a razón de uno por cada provincia y uno por el Distrito Nacional, cuyo ejercicio durará cuatro años. (Art. 78)

Legislature
- English
...
Paragraph 3. The conditions for eligibility, according to the law, are:
I – the Brazilian nationality;
II – the full exercise of the political rights;
III – the electoral enrollment;
IV – the electoral domicile in the electoral district;
V – the membership in a political party;
VI – the minimum age of:
a) thirty-five years for President and Vice-President of the Republic and Senator;
...
c) twenty-one years for Federal Deputy, State or District Deputy, Mayor, Vice-Mayor, and justice of the peace;
...
Paragraph 4. The illiterate and those that cannot be registered as voters are not eligible.
... (Art. 14) - Portuguese

Legislature
- EnglishThe legislative power belongs to the Congress of the Republic, made up of deputies elected directly by the people by universal and secret suffrage, through the system of electoral districts and [by] national list, for a period of four years, being able to be reelected.
Each one of the Departments of the Republic, constitutes an electoral district. The Municipality of Guatemala forms the central district and the other Municipalities of the department of Guatemala constitute the district of Guatemala. For each electoral district a minimum of one deputy must be elected. The law establishes the number of deputies that correspond to each district according to its population. A number equivalent to twenty-five percent of the district deputies shall be directly elected as deputies by [the process of] national list.
… (Art. 157) - SpanishLa potestad legislativa corresponde al Congreso de la República, compuesto por diputados electos directamente por el pueblo en sufragio universal y secreto, por el sistema de distritos electorales y lista nacional, para un período de cuatro años, pudiendo ser reelectos.
